Swamp Fibres live in environments lacking in oxygen by metabolizing methane produced by decomposing organic matter. The Fibres tangle together, making the water torpid and viscous... like a sort of fibrous gelatin, which increases the stagnancy and aids the Swamp Fibres. Water infested with Swamp Fibres is unusually black and opaque.
